Current Pricing Landscape for Hell's Kitchen Rentals

Hell's Kitchen parking rates vary seasonally and by location precision. Daily spots near 44 & X Hell's Kitchen (622 10th Avenue) typically command $21 to $35, reflecting proximity to Hudson Line station. Event-specific parking during Madison Square Garden concerts or Broadway premieres jumps to $28 to $40 daily. Premium garage spaces with covered protection naturally cost more than open driveway spots, but all command premium Hell's Kitchen rates compared to outer boroughs.

Weekly parking rentals offer better value for extended visits. Expect $150 to $250 per week for driveways, garages, or stacked parking depending on amenities and exact location. Monthly rentals prove most economical for long-term needs, averaging $500 to $750. Seasonal fluctuations matter too—summer tourist season and holiday periods see 15-20% price increases. Most successful hosts adjust rates dynamically, charging $35 weekends but dropping to $21 on quiet Tuesday mornings to maintain occupancy.

What lease terms are common for parking spaces in Hell's Kitchen?

Lease terms for parking spaces in Hell's Kitchen can vary, but many options offer monthly rentals or hourly/daily rates. Most monthly parking agreements range from 30 to 90 days, making it flexible for commuters. Be sure to check cancellation policies, as some facilities may require a notice period if you decide to vacate your space.
